Visualization System is used to examine bile duct.

Boston Scientific Corp.    Natick, MA 01760
Jun 11, 2007 SpyGlass(TM) Direct Visualization System for duodenoscope assisted cholangiopancreatoscopy enables direct visualization of all bile-duct quadrants. It provides 4-way steerability and irrigation channels as well as 1.2 mm working channel through which diagnostic and therapeutic devices can be used. Miniature 6,000-pixel fiber-optic probe that attaches to camera head is inserted through single-use catheter that can access and inspect treatment area.

Software cuts virtual machine backup times.

EMC Corp.    Hopkinton, MA 01748-9103
Jun 11, 2007 Supporting VMwareŽ Consolidated Backup, AvamarŽ v3.7 transforms data protection process using global de-deduplication technology, which eliminates unnecessary transmission of redundant backup data sent over network to secondary storage. By de-duplicating at source, customers can shrink amount of time required for backups. De-duplication capabilities can also be used with EMC Celerra NAS systems, via NDMP backups, to accelerate full backup of file systems.

Self-Healing Ethernet Switches minimize network downtime.

Moxa Inc.    Brea, CA 92823
Jun 11, 2007 Moxa redundant self-healing Turbo Ring switches help end users minimize downtime caused by network failure. If any link in ring fails, system will return to normal communication in less than 20 ms at full load. Various topologies can be configured, including ring coupling without coupling control line, dual rings in one switch, and dual-homing.

Pattern Generator Boards produce differential signals.

Strategic Test Corporation    Woburn, MA 01801-1915
Jun 11, 2007 Available in 4 models, Digital Pattern Generator boards for PC's feature up to 32 Gigabit memory, maximum clock rates of 40, 10, or 5 MHz, and choice of 16- or 32-bit widths. They generate ECL, PECL, TTL, LVDS, LVTTL, CMOS, or LVCMOS signal. Each 4-bit nibble can be programmed with different high and low output level from -2 to +10 V in 10 mV increments. Output rate of signals can be programmed from dc to 40 MHz and each channel can drive max current of 100 mA (max 200 mA per nibble).

Machine Vision Camera does not require frame grabber.

Prosilica Inc.    Burnaby V5J 5E9  Canada
Jun 11, 2007 Running 60 fps at 752 x 480 resolutions over GigE Vision-compliant Gigabit Ethernet interface, Model GC750 connects directly to Gigabit Ethernet port on host computer. It features progressive scan CMOS sensor with global electronic shutter suited for capturing high-speed motion events. Sensor offers good near IR sensitivity and antiblooming properties designed for license plate reading and traffic applications. Camera comes in monochrome and color models supporting 8- and 10-bit formats.
